Having my own lived experience with both BiPolar II Depression and Alcoholism, I have always found it both comforting and inspiring to listen to other people’s lived experiences. Their courage and vulnerability offered me the hope I desperately needed and inspired me to launch a podcast dedicated solely to sharing people's lived experience with different mental health and behavioral challenges. Each week a courageous guest will share with us what their life was like before, during and after their respective experiences and some advice they'd give to those who are struggling today.
